PPTM konvertálása JPG-vé a GroupDocs.Conversion for .NET használatával: lépésről lépésre útmutató
Bevezetés
A PowerPoint-bemutatók képformátumokba, például JPG-be konvertálása elengedhetetlen a diák e-mailben történő megosztásakor vagy weboldalakba ágyazásakor. Ez az oktatóanyag zökkenőmentes és hatékony módszert kínál a jelszóval védett PPTM-fájlok JPG formátumba konvertálására a GroupDocs.Conversion for .NET segítségével. Megtanulod, hogyan állítsd be a fejlesztői környezetet, hogyan kövesd a lépésről lépésre szóló utasításokat C#-ban, és hogyan fedezd fel a funkció valós alkalmazásait.
Előfeltételek
Mielőtt elkezdené, győződjön meg arról, hogy a következőkkel rendelkezik:
Szükséges könyvtárak és függőségek
- GroupDocs.Conversion .NET-hezGyőződjön meg arról, hogy a 25.3.0-s verzió telepítve van.
Környezeti beállítási követelmények
- Egy kompatibilis IDE, mint például a Visual Studio.
- C# programozási alapismeretek.
Ismereti előfeltételek
- Az alapvető fájl I/O műveletek ismerete .NET-ben.
- Ismerkedés a NuGet csomagkezeléssel.
A GroupDocs.Conversion beállítása .NET-hez
Telepítse a GroupDocs.Conversion könyvtárat a következővel: NuGet csomagkezelő konzol vagy a .NET parancssori felület:
NuGet csomagkezelő konzol
Install-Package GroupDocs.Conversion -Version 25.3.0
.NET parancssori felület
dotnet add package GroupDocs.Conversion --version 25.3.0
Licencbeszerzés lépései
A GroupDocs különféle licencelési lehetőségeket kínál:
- Ingyenes próbaverzió: Kezdje egy ingyenes próbaverzióval a funkciók teszteléséhez.
- Ideiglenes engedély: Szerezd meg ezt egy hosszabb próbaidőszakra.
- Vásárlás: Szerezzen be egy állandó licencet a teljes hozzáféréshez.
Alapvető inicializálás és beállítás C#-ban
Inicializálja a GroupDocs.Conversion függvényt a projektben az alábbiak szerint:
using System;
using GroupDocs.Conversion;
class Program
{
static void Main()
{
// Inicializálja a konvertert
using (Converter converter = new Converter("sample.pptm"))
{
Console.WriteLine("Converter initialized successfully.");
}
}
}
Ez a kódrészlet egy alapvető konverziós példányt állít be. Csere "sample.pptm"
a tényleges fájlelérési úttal.
Megvalósítási útmutató
PPTM fájl betöltése és konvertálása JPG-vé
GroupDocs.Conversion segítségével jelszóval védett PowerPoint (PPTM) dokumentumok minden egyes diáját különálló, kiváló minőségű JPG képekké alakíthatja.
Áttekintés
Betöltjük a PPTM fájlt, és minden oldalt JPG képpé konvertálunk.
1. lépés: Kimeneti könyvtár és fájlelnevezési sablon meghatározása
Adja meg, hogy hová kerüljenek mentésre a konvertált képek:
string outputFolder = "YOUR_OUTPUT_DIRECTORY/";
string outputFileTemplate = System.IO.Path.Combine(outputFolder, "converted-page-{0}.jpg");
Ez a beállítás helyőrzőket használ a dinamikus fájlnevekhez.
2. lépés: Hozz létre egy függvényt képfolyamok generálásához
Definiáljon egy függvényt, amely streameket hoz létre az egyes konvertált oldalak mentéséhez:
Func<SavePageContext, Stream> getPageStream = savePageContext =>
new System.IO.FileStream(System.String.Format(outputFileTemplate, savePageContext.Page), System.IO.FileMode.Create);
Ez biztosítja, hogy minden dia külön JPG fájlként kerüljön mentésre.
3. lépés: Töltse be és konvertálja a PPTM fájlt
A konverzió végrehajtásához töltse be a dokumentumot, és alkalmazza a szükséges beállításokat:
using (Converter converter = new Converter("YOUR_DOCUMENT_DIRECTORY/sample.pptm"))
{
ImageConvertOptions options = new ImageConvertOptions { Format = ImageFileType.Jpg };
// Hajtsa végre a konverziót
converter.Convert(getPageStream, options);
}
Itt, ImageConvertOptions
JPG formátumra konvertálást határozza meg.
Hibaelhárítási tippek
- Győződjön meg arról, hogy a kimeneti könyvtár létezik és írható.
- Ellenőrizze, hogy a PPTM fájl elérési útja helyes-e.
- Ellenőrizze a licencelési problémákat, ha hibák merülnek fel az átalakítás során.
Gyakorlati alkalmazások
A prezentációk képekké konvertálása számos lehetőséget nyit meg:
- E-mail mellékletek: Diák megosztása képként e-mailekben, biztosítva az eszközök közötti kompatibilitást.
- Webintegráció: Ágyazzon be diákat weboldalakba vagy blogokba a jobb vizuális élmény érdekében.
- DokumentumjelentésekDiavizualizációk beillesztése PDF-jelentésekbe PowerPoint nélkül.
Teljesítménybeli szempontok
A konverziós folyamat optimalizálásához:
- Figyelje az erőforrás-felhasználást a túlzott memóriafelhasználás elkerülése érdekében.
- Használjon hatékony fájlkezelési gyakorlatokat, különösen nagyméretű prezentációk esetén.
- Hibakezelés implementálása a váratlan problémák szabályos kezelése érdekében.
Ezen irányelvek betartásával biztosíthatja a zökkenőmentes és hatékony konverziós folyamatot.
Következtetés
Elsajátítottad a PPTM fájlok JPG formátumba konvertálásának képességét a GroupDocs.Conversion for .NET segítségével. Ez a hatékony eszköz leegyszerűsíti a folyamatot, és javítja a prezentációk különböző digitális formátumokba integrálásának képességét.
Következő lépések? Fedezze fel a GroupDocs.Conversion további funkcióit, vagy próbálja meg integrálni ezt a funkciót a meglévő alkalmazásaiba.
GYIK szekció
- Konvertálhatok egyszerre több PPTM fájlt?
- Igen, fájlelérési utak egy gyűjteményén iterálva, és ugyanazon konverziós logika alkalmazásával.
- Mi van, ha a kimeneti könyvtáram nem létezik?
- A hibák elkerülése érdekében mindenképpen hozza létre a konvertálási folyamat futtatása előtt.
- Hogyan kezeljem hatékonyan a nagyméretű prezentációkat?
- Fontolja meg az átalakítás kisebb tételekre bontását vagy a rendszererőforrások optimalizálását.
- Ingyenes a GroupDocs.Conversion kereskedelmi célú felhasználásra?
- Ideiglenes licenc érhető el, de a teljes körű kereskedelmi használathoz vásárlás szükséges.
- Milyen formátumokat tud kezelni a GroupDocs.Conversion a JPG-n kívül?
- Számos dokumentum- és képformátumot támogat, beleértve a PDF, PNG, BMP és egyebeket.
Erőforrás
További információért és támogatásért:
A GroupDocs.Conversion for .NET használatával nemcsak fájlokat konvertálsz, hanem az információk megosztásának és bemutatásának módját is javítod. Jó kódolást!